Christina Mavrogianni is a Teaching Professor in the Department of Nutrition and Dietetics at Harokopio University. She joined the Laboratory Teaching Staff in November 2023. Her research focuses on obesity-related risk factors, lifestyle intervention programs, and digital health technologies in preventing chronic diseases, particularly in children and adults. She holds a PhD in Nutrition Science (2020) from Harokopio University, a MSc in Clinical Nutrition (2011), and a BSc in Nutrition and Dietetics (2009).
Her research interests include school/community-based interventions, dietary patterns and chronic disease relationships, perinatal obesity risk factors, and infant nutrition. Key publications include studies on parental diabetes risk predicting offspring obesity, food parenting practices in child nutrition, and vitamin D supplementation effects in postmenopausal women.
Recent work explores digital health interventions for diabetes screening (DigiCare4You), policy frameworks for childhood obesity, and metabolic syndrome risk associated with beverage consumption. Her articles highlight interdisciplinary approaches to public health challenges, emphasizing family dynamics and socioeconomic factors.
